PERCEPTIONS...

I hear you.

If life were fair then there would be so much in the world that would never have existed. There would be so many things that we’d never have to experience, that we’d never have to witness.
There would be no such thing as pain. No such thing as suffering. No such thing as hate.
There would be no such thing as fear.
If life were fair, this would be heaven.

But as much as we would all like it to be it isn’t. Life can be hell. Life can be unfair. Life can be hard. It can be painful. It can be sad. It can be everything we fear.
Life can be cruel.
Such is the way of things, to see the dark to appreciate the light, to find the light to guide us out of the dark. Life’s great duality, from one to the other and back again.

I hear you.

It would be easier if life were fair, and if not fair, then at least, if life were easier.
Where is the balance? We ask when all seems bleak. When trial after trial tests us blindly and we see dark flashing by time after time after time. Where is the balance in this?

I hear you.

When you plead with those you look to for salvation, for some kind of peace - a break in between the challenges you face.

I hear you.

Now hear me.

When you see the dark flashing by, you never notice the flashes of light in between.
You look at the things that tie you down and trouble you, for the heavy feelings are so much harder to shake. They influence your perception because it is easier to fall than it is to fly.
It is harder to pick yourself up when you are down and climb back to where you stood before.
The little things that make a difference seem insignificant in comparison.

But the little things, they are the world. A hug. A sunrise. A friend. A lover. A moment.
In the dark a flash of light reveals all.
In the light, a flash of dark is a shadow and nothing more.
I hear you but you look away from me.
The light is right here. It is just as powerful, just as prevalent as the dark. It’s all just a matter of focus.

You dwell on the dark.
Now hear me.
It is time to dwell on the light.
